Fun Fact #15
-----------------------
Despite the fact that most people (especially politicians) speak English these days, there are still 24 working languages in the EU. When asked why they promote multilinguism, the offiial answer was: "EU language policies aim to protect linguistic diversity and to promote knowledge of languages for reasons of cultural identity, social integration and because multilingual citizens are better placed to take advantage of education and job opportunities in the Single Market."
